Wire Bonding: An important Step in Semiconductor Packaging
Wire bonding is a method made use of to make electrical connections amongst a semiconductor die and its packaging or other parts. The wires are typically fabricated from gold, aluminum, or copper, with bonding wire for semiconductor apps staying a vital aspect of this method.

Die Bonding: Attaching the Semiconductor Die
Die bonding is the entire process of attaching a semiconductor die to a substrate or a bundle. The die bonding course of action is critical for making certain appropriate electrical and thermal general performance of the ultimate semiconductor deal.

Wire Bonding Materials as well as their Importance
Wire bonding product performs a significant job in determining the trustworthiness and general performance of your semiconductor deal. The mostly utilized supplies consist of:

Gold: Favored for its exceptional conductivity and resistance to corrosion.
Copper: A more Expense-helpful choice to gold, giving large conductivity but requiring thorough dealing with to prevent oxidation.
Aluminum: Employed in wedge bonding resulting from its superior conductivity and lower cost when compared with gold.
